Volunteering for Great Parks of Hamilton County will lead you to fun, rewarding and unforgettable experiences! Help with invasive plant removal, patrol one of our more than 70 miles of trails, volunteer at our Shaker Trace Nursery or interact directly with park guests at one of our gift shops, visitor centers or nature programs. Join our outstanding team of volunteers and staff members and learn new skills, meet people with similar interests, all while making a difference in your community. Whether you have time to volunteer long-term, a few weeks or only once or twice a year, Great Parks of Hamilton County has a place for you! It's fun, rewarding and easy to get involved. Miami Fort Trail Stiltgrass Pull-o-thon at Shawnee Lookout

Shawnee Lookout needs help in pulling invasive Japanese stiltgrass along the Miami Fort Trail. Running buffalo clover is a rare native plant species with a thriving population along the Miami Fort Trail. To manage the clover, we need to remove invasive competitors, such as Japanese stiltgrass, by using a combination of pulling, mowing, and treating, so that we give the running buffalo clover the best chance to thrive along the trail.
